Add and simplify. 1 1/3 + 2 3/4

Answer: 4\ \frac{1}{12}

Step-by-step explanation:

We can convert the Mixed numbers to Improper fractions:

- Multiply the the whole number part by the denominator of the fraction.

- Add the product obtained and the numerator of the fraction.

- The sum obtained will be the new numerator.

- The denominator does not change.

Then:

(1\ \frac{1}{3})+(2\ \frac{3}{4})=\frac{(1*3)+1}{3}+\frac{(4*2)+3}{4}=\frac{4}{3}+\frac{11}{4}

Now find the Least Common Denominator (LCD) and add the fractions:

=\frac{16+33}{12}=\frac{49}{12}

Finally, you can convert back to Mixed numbers:

-Divide the numerator by the denominator.

- Write the whole number.

- The remainder will be the new numerator.

- The denominator does not change.

Then:

=4\ \frac{1}{12}

Find the product of (x^2+2x-3)(4x^2-5x+6)
Evgesh-ka [11]

Answer:

x^{4} + 3x³ - 16x² + 27x - 18

Step-by-step explanation:

Each term in the second factor is multiplied by each term in the first factor, that is

x²(4x² - 5x + 6) + 2x(4x² - 5x + 6) - 3(4x² - 5x + 6)

Distribute all 3 parenthesis

= 4x^{4} - 5x³ + 6x² + 8x³ - 10x² + 12x - 12x² + 15x - 18

Collecting like terms

= 4x^{4} + 3x³ - 16x² + 27x - 18
